Hi.
I have tried to hook up my pokeys board to do some testing with Mach3.
When I program as an example pin 1 for x axis (left arrow or right arrow) and do a send to device, if I click on the menu at the top of mach3 screen, each menu start to open from left to right on a non stop way.
On the window screen, if I double click on a icon, instead of opening the software, it act as I right click and got the property window.
I tried with a NO switch and a NC switch and it does the same thing.
If I try without opening Mach3, it affect the computer and have to press reset or disconnect the pokey board to get control of my computer.

I have tried to switch to another USB input on my computer and it looks like this solve some problems. Was hooked up to the front input and tried to connect it to a USB input on the back of the computer.
I made some more testing and now I can move axis. Will do more testins later.
